新聞中心
jQuery是一個非常強(qiáng)大的JavaScript庫,它可以幫助我們輕松地處理HTML文檔、事件、動畫等,在本文中,我們將介紹如何使用jQuery實(shí)現(xiàn)表格序號隨自動增加行變化的功能。

我們需要創(chuàng)建一個HTML表格,如下所示:
| 姓名 | 年齡 | 城市 |
|---|---|---|
| 張三 | 25 | 北京 |
| 李四 | 30 | 上海 |
接下來,我們需要引入jQuery庫,可以通過以下方式將其添加到HTML文件中:
我們可以開始編寫jQuery代碼來實(shí)現(xiàn)表格序號隨自動增加行變化的功能,我們需要為表格的每一行添加一個序號列,可以使用“元素創(chuàng)建一個新的表頭單元格,并為其添加一個類名(例如`number`):
| 姓名 | 年齡 | 序號 | 城市 |
|---|---|---|---|
| 張三 | 25 | 1 | 北京 |
| 李四 | 30 | 2 | 上海 |
接下來,我們需要編寫jQuery代碼來處理行的增加操作,當(dāng)表格的行數(shù)發(fā)生變化時,我們需要更新序號列的內(nèi)容,可以使用`$(document).ready()`函數(shù)確保在DOM加載完成后執(zhí)行代碼,并使用`trigger()`函數(shù)觸發(fā)`insertRow`事件以插入新行,我們可以使用`find()`函數(shù)找到序號列的第一個單元格,并為其添加一個新的序號值,以下是完整的jQuery代碼:
$(document).ready(function () {
// 當(dāng)表格的行數(shù)發(fā)生變化時,執(zhí)行以下操作
$('table tr').on('insertRow', function () {
// 獲取當(dāng)前行的序號列的第一個單元格,并為其添加一個新的序號值
$(this).find('.number').first().text($(this).index() + 1);
});
});
當(dāng)我們在表格中添加或刪除行時,序號列的內(nèi)容將自動更新,這就是如何使用jQuery實(shí)現(xiàn)表格序號隨自動增加行變化的功能。
網(wǎng)頁標(biāo)題:jquery怎么實(shí)現(xiàn)表格序號隨自動增加行變化
轉(zhuǎn)載來源:http://www.5511xx.com/article/cddshej.html


咨詢
建站咨詢
